Output 51e68290c85ef9d6184b3f14adc1505e5a4e6ba97ec018ae832a6f2b42e90aa6:22

value
1552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6db7a719aa2ac2038cc54f180245cae776f51d7f OP_EQUAL
address
DF9ECaos8XMxr4Z88xerwa9SNm9Vjaq3vo
transaction
51e68290c85ef9d6184b3f14adc1505e5a4e6ba97ec018ae832a6f2b42e90aa6
spent
true